Rental Reimbursement and Road Service

Help When You Need it Most

One of the last things you want to worry about after a car accident is how you’re going to get around without your car or pay for other transportation. Since an automobile policy doesn’t automatically cover the cost of a replacement car after an accident, rental reimbursement and towing coverage is an inexpensive insurance option that can help when you need it most.

Rental Reimbursement Coverage

Rental reimbursement coverage can be added to your auto policy for only a few extra dollars a month. Considering the average time a car is in the repair shop after an accident is 14 days, your out-of-pocket expenses can add up quickly.

Coverage is subject to a daily and per accident limit. For example, a $40 per day/$1200 per accident rental reimbursement limit means you’ll be covered up to $40 a day and no more than $1200 per each covered accident. There’s a variety of limits and per occurrence options to choose from.

Towing and Road Service Coverage

Towing and road service is an additional coverage option that’s there for you when life throw an unexpected mishap your way. For a nominal annual fee, a dispatch service will send the nearest qualified emergency roadside assistance from a network of towing, road service and locksmith professionals. That way, help is never more than a phone call away.
